    Costco's gas stations are open different hours than the warehouse clubs so they deserve to be a separate business. This gas station is open 6am to 9:30pm Monday to Friday and then 7am to 7pm on weekends. On this rainy Monday morning, there was almost no wait and I was able to fill up very quickly. At peak times on weekends, you could be waiting a half hour. Is 30 minutes of your time really worth the $2 you might save on 20 gallons of fuel? Use either side! Yes, you can use the pumps with the fuel on either side regardless of where the fuel filler is on your car as they have extra long hoses that will fit over just about every car. Not my Sprinter van though! They do not have squeegees and do not sell any of the usual gas station / convenience store merchandise. This is fuel only. You do need to be a member of Costco to use the gas station. Your lower prices are sometimes more than 10c better here than at local gas stations because your annual membership is subsidizing the price.     I came here after hitting a curb -- my steering wheel was off-center and I needed an alignment…read more They performed the alignment and charged me for it, but the steering wheel was still crooked afterward. I then took my car to the Mercedes dealership for an inspection. Their master technician told me directly: the shop should never have performed the alignment in the first place. There was visible damage to the tie rod, steering rack, and wheel bearing -- damage that any competent technician would have seen the moment the car was put on an alignment rack. Here's the thing: an alignment cannot hold or function correctly when the underlying components are damaged. With a bent tie rod, a compromised steering rack, and a bad wheel bearing, the alignment settings will be inaccurate from the start -- or revert immediately once you drive. This shop either didn't know that, or knew it and did the alignment anyway to collect payment. Neither is acceptable. Instead of being honest about the damage and referring me to a proper repair facility, they charged me for a service that was completely ineffective and a total waste of money. If your car has been in any kind of impact, do not bring it here. They will perform services they know cannot fix your problem just to take your money.
